Vacancy caducado!
KORE1, a nationwide provider of staffing and recruiting solutions, has an immediate opening for a
Software Engineer: .NET core (web) + API + SQL + React, AWS, or Azure required (AWS serverless, Python, NoSQL a +) The Software Engineer will apply principles and techniques of computer science, engineering and analysis to provide software solutions. He/she will assist in designing and developing front-end software, server-side software, and databases. Job Expectations + Essential Functions- Analyze software requirements to determine feasibility of design within time and budget constraints
- Develop web applications ensuring cross-platform (web and mobile) optimization
- Develop software solutions by studying information needs; conferring with users; studying systems flow, data usage, and work processes; investigating problem areas; following the software development lifecycle
- Document solutions as appropriate using flowcharts, layouts, diagrams, charts, code comments, etc.
- Update job knowledge by studying state-of-the-art development tools, programming techniques, and computing equipment; participating in educational opportunities; reading professional publications; maintaining personal networks; participating in professional organizations
- Troubleshoot complex software and system issues; drive root cause understanding and implement corrective actions; provide timely communications back to customers and key stakeholders.
- Bachelor’s Degree in Computer Science, Software Engineering, or equivalent experience.
- 5+ years’ experience developing web applications with:
- ASP.NET
- .NET Core
- C#
- Web services
- REST API design
- MS SQL including database schema design (2016 or newer preferred), database stored procedures, triggers, views, and jobs.
- HTML, CSS, JavaScript, jQuery a plus
- Proficient in using Git and Visual Studio
- Required to have 1 or more of the following:
- Single page application JavaScript (React preferred, Angular in lieu of may be considered)
- Cloud experience (AWS preferred, Azure in lieu of may be considered)
- AWS serverless (lambda functions) / experience with Serverless Framework
- Python, Boto3, Flask scripting (for serverless AWS)
- Other nice to haves:
- SQS
- DynamoDB or NoSQL database
- CloudWatch
- Experience with IoT systems
- Experience with Agile development, DevOps, CI/CD, Test Automation frameworks is highly desirable.
- Performance Optimization
- Secure design and coding
- Highly-available distributed systems design
- Experience in working in small cohesive teams
- Expert in performing root-cause analysis and troubleshooting complex system issues.
- Codes software applications to adhere to designs supporting internal business requirements or external customers.
- Has knowledge of standard concepts, practices, and procedures.
- Relies on experience and judgment to plan and accomplish goals. Performs a variety of tasks. A wide degree of creativity and latitude required.
- Analyzing Information, General Programming Skills, Software Design, Software Debugging, Software Documentation, Software Testing, Problem Solving, Teamwork, Software Development Fundamentals, Software Development Process, Software Requirements.